Construction underway on Pflugerville Solar Project

​​​PFLUGERVILLE – Work has started on Recurrent Energy’s 144-megawatt, 950-acre solar project.

The Pflugerville Solar Project will power the equivalent of 25,000 homes.

Austin-based RigUp is hiring up to 350 skilled workers for the project. 

To support construction, Recurrent recently received debt and tax equity financing totaling more than $234 million. U.S. Bank provided tax equinity, and a bank club led by CIT provided debt financing.
